The SAMHSA Federal Helpline
Need assistance ? Call the SAMHSA Federal Helpline at 1-800-662-HELP (4357). This is a private and free referral service, available 24/7, providing links to local therapy programs, mutual meetings , and community-based agencies . The Helpline offers service in both English and Spanish.
